In 2021, Advance Intelligence Group implemented BIPO HRMS as its Core HR platform to consolidate global human resources functions. The program was led by a People Tech Lead who directed a team of 20 HR professionals across SEA and China to build a scalable HR system for a 2,500 employee professional services firm headquartered in Singapore. The BIPO HRMS deployment centralized core HR modules including a staff database, leave management, attendance tracking, overtime processing, payroll, and claims for 11 countries. The implementation also encompassed a performance rating system fully integrated with the group document and messaging platform, automated onboarding and exit interview workflows, and a 360 review capability, reflecting a configuration-centric approach to employee lifecycle management. Integrations were explicit and extensive, with Greenhouse and Moka ATS systems integrated into the BIPO HRIS for recruitment workflows, and Lark Suite technologies used for permission controlled auto datasheets, interactive forms, and document orchestration via Lark Bitable. Custom tooling and data pipelines were developed with Python, Pandas, and Excel VBA, while management reporting was delivered through a People Dashboard built in Power BI and interactive visualizations using Dashplotly. Governance and rollout activities included structured requirement gathering, vendor selection, organizational structure review, and a three year system planning horizon. Deliverables included user guides, staff training, ongoing day to day consultation to internal teams on systems and data integration, and configuration practices designed to scale with business operations, ensuring HR, recruitment, payroll, finance and management reporting functions were aligned with the BIPO HRMS implementation. Advance Intelligence Group BIPO HRMS Core HR serves as the system of record for personnel data and HR operational workflows, with integrated recruitment, performance, onboarding, payroll, and project cost tracking modules tied into Lark Suite and external ATS platforms.

In 2023, AltitudeX Singapore implemented BIPO HRMS in the Core HR category to consolidate payroll and core HR operations for its Singapore entity. The deployment targeted the HR and Finance functions for a 40 person leisure and hospitality operator, positioning BIPO HRMS as the primary system for payroll processing, statutory reporting and employee lifecycle management. BIPO HRMS was configured to support monthly and ad hoc payroll processing, statutory submissions and annual tax filing processes cited as IR21 and IR8A, and maintenance of payroll supporting documentation for internal and external audit purposes. The implementation encompassed leave management, overtime and commission verification, annual appraisals, recruitment and onboarding workflows, exit interview and exit clearance processing, repatriation handling, and insurance and medical administration consistent with Core HR functionality. Operational governance was structured around formal payroll authorizations and documentation retention, with workflow controls for timely statutory payments and government claim processing including NS reservist claims, childcare and maternity leaves. Day to day operational ownership was assigned to HR with payroll reconciliation touchpoints to Finance, enabling centralized HR database management and standardized processes for work pass applications including EP, S Pass and WP handling.

In 2022, AMOS Group implemented BIPO HRMS to centralize Core HR functions and strengthen HR analytics and payroll controls across its Singapore operations and regional reporting lines. The deployment targeted employee database management, payroll processing for Singapore, leave administration, claims management, rewards administration, and HR reporting to support the Group HR and HRBP networks. Configuration emphasized HR analytics and reporting capabilities, configuring BIPO HRMS to capture headcount, turnover, retention, diversity and payroll transaction data, and to feed dynamic dashboards. The implementation included design of standardized data models and validation rules, configuration of payroll cycles, and setup of workforce planning and rewards modules to support salary structure and incentive analysis. Operational integration focused on aligning BIPO HRMS outputs with Group HR and Group Finance processes and with HRBP workflows for regional consolidation. Analytics workflows were extended to modern BI tools such as Power BI to produce leadership dashboards and regional reports, enabling consolidated HR reporting across multiple countries while maintaining Singapore payroll compliance and records accuracy. Governance workstreams formalized HRIS ownership, data integrity controls, payroll procedures and audit support, and introduced process automation for onboarding, terminations and payroll reconciliations. The deployment supported stated objectives of accurate and timely employee payments, regulatory compliance for payroll and tax obligations in Singapore, and ongoing HR process improvements through enhanced reporting and automation.
